S T A T E O F N E W Y O R K ________________________________________________________________________ 7224 2009-2010 Regular Sessions I N A S S E M B L Y March 26, 2009 ___________ Introduced by M. of A. MILLER, TEDISCO, BOYLE -- Multi-Sponsored by -- M. of A. BACALLES, CAHILL, CROUCH, MAYERSOHN, SAYWARD, SCOZZAFAVA -- read once and referred to the Committee on Aging AN ACT to amend the elder law, in relation to establishing an elderly dental insurance coverage program; and making an appropriation there- for TH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M- B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. Article 2 of the elder law is amended by adding a new title 5 to read as follows: TITLE 5 ELDERLY DENTAL INSURANCE COVERAGE PROGRAM SECTION 270. DEFINITIONS. 271. ELDERLY DENTAL INSURANCE COVERAGE PROGRAM. 272. P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Y. 273. REGULATIONS. 274. PENALTIES FOR FRAUD AND ABUSE. S 270. DEFINITIONS. FOR PURPOSES OF THIS TITLE, THE TERMS: 1. "INCOME" SHALL MEAN "HOUSEHOLD GROSS INCOME" AS DEFINED IN THE REAL PROPERTY TAX CIRCUIT BREAKER CREDIT PROGRAM, PURSUANT TO SUBPARAGRAPH (C) OF PARAGRAPH ONE OF SUBSECTION (E) OF SECTION SIX HUNDRED SIX OF THE TAX LAW, BUT ONLY SHALL INCLUDE THE INCOME OF PROGRAM APPLICANTS AND SPOUSES AND SHALL EXCLUDE THE INCOME OF OTHER MEMBERS OF THE HOUSEHOLD. 2. "RESIDENT" SHALL MEAN AN INDIVIDUAL LEGALLY DOMICILED WITHIN THE STATE. S 271. ELDERLY DENTAL INSURANCE COVERAGE PROGRAM. THE DIRECTOR SHALL ESTABLISH AN ELDERLY DENTAL INSURANCE COVERAGE PROGRAM, IN CONSULTATION WITH THE COMMISSIONER OF CIVIL SERVICE, WITHIN THE STATE EMPLOYEE DENTAL INSURANCE PLAN. SUCH PROGRAM SHALL PROVIDE COMPREHENSIVE AND ROUTINE DENTAL CARE SERVICES TO SENIOR RESIDENTS WHO MEET THE PROGRAM ELIGIBIL- EXPLANATION--Matter in ITALICS (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[ ] is old law to be omitted.
